FG unveils name, logo of new national flag carrier
The Nigerian government has unveiled the name and logo of the new national flag carrier.
The national airline is named Nigeria Air.
The unveiling was done at Farnborough Air Show in London.
The airshow is the meeting place where aircraft manufacturers, engine manufacturers, aircraft leasing companies, aviation consultants and marketers gather every two years to do business.
“The new national carrier will bring Nigeria closer to the world,” the presidency said.

The Minister of State for Aviation, Sen. Hadi Sirika during the conference said “It is a business, not a social service. Government will not be involved in running it or deciding who runs it. The investors will have full responsibility for this.”
